Najnowsze tutoriale tworzenie stron internetowych
 

jQuery pagebeforehide Event

<JQuery Mobilna Wydarzenia

Przykład

Alert jakiś tekst, gdy strona przechodzimy od, ma być ukryta:

$(document).on("pagebeforehide","#pagetwo",function(){
  alert("pagebeforehide event fired - pagetwo is about to be hidden");
});
Spróbuj sam "

Definicja i Wykorzystanie

Impreza pagebeforehide jest uruchamiany na "from" stronie, przed rozpoczęciem animacji przejścia.

Podobne wydarzenia:

  • pagehide - uruchomione na "from" stronie, po zakończeniu animacji przejścia
  • pagebeforeshow - uruchomione na "to" stronie, przed zakończeniem animacja przejścia
  • pageshow - uruchomione na "to" strony, po zakończeniu animacji przejścia

Uwaga: To zdarzenie jest wywoływane za każdym razem, przejście Strona rozpoczyna / zatrzymuje.


Składnia

Aby wyzwolić zdarzenie dla wszystkich stron w jQuery komórkowy:

$("document").on("pagebeforehide",function(event){...}) Try it

Aby wyzwolić zdarzenie dla konkretnej strony:

$("document").on("pagebeforehide"," page ",function(event){...}) Try it

Parametr Opis
function(event,data) Wymagany. Określa funkcję uruchamiania, gdy wystąpi zdarzenie pagebeforehide.

Funkcja ma dwa opcjonalne parametry:

  • Obiekt zdarzenia - które mogą zawierać żadnych właściwości zdarzeń jQuery (np event.target, Event.type itp) Zobacz jQuery zdarzenia Reference , aby uzyskać więcej informacji
  • Obiekt danych - zawiera jedną właściwość, The nextPage, która zwraca stronę przechodzimy
page Opcjonalny. Punkty do identyfikatora strony, aby określić zdarzenie pagebeforehide dla. Dla stron wewnętrznych, użyj #id . W przypadku stron zewnętrznych, należy externalfile.html .

Spróbuj sam - przykłady

Demonstracja zdarzeń ich dotyczących
Wykazanie, że pokazuje, kiedy pagebeforeshow, pageshow, pagebeforehide i pagehide pożar.

Obiekt zdarzenia
Korzystanie z własności event.timeStamp.

Obiekt danych
Korzystanie z nextPage właściwość, aby powrócić na stronę przechodzimy.


<JQuery Mobilna Wydarzenia